Remove and replace the door speaker in a 2018-2024 Toyota Camry by removing the door panel, disconnecting the wiring harness, and installing the new speaker.

Warnings

Plastic door panel clips break easily. Apply steady, even pressure when removing the panel to minimize breakage.
ℹ️The window must be fully raised before removing the door panel to prevent glass damage.

Preparation

  1. Park vehicle on level surface and engage parking brake
  2. Raise all windows completely
  3. Disconnect negative battery terminal to prevent short circuits during speaker replacement
  4. Wait 3 minutes after battery disconnect for airbag system to discharge
  5. Gather replacement speaker and verify it matches the original size and mounting pattern

Procedure

  1. 1
    Remove door panel screws
    Remove the Phillips screw located in the door pull handle recess. Remove the screw behind the interior door handle trim piece (may require prying the trim piece loose first). On front doors, remove any additional screws in the lower corner of the door panel.
  2. 2
    Detach door panel clips
    Using a panel removal tool, carefully pry around the perimeter of the door panel starting at the bottom rear corner. Work your way around the panel, releasing each retaining clip. There are typically 8-10 clips holding the panel. Pull gently outward once clips are released, but do not fully remove yet.
  3. 3
    Disconnect electrical connectors
    Reach behind the door panel and disconnect all electrical connectors for power windows, door locks, and mirror controls. Press the locking tab on each connector before pulling straight out. Lift the door panel up and away from the door frame to fully remove it.
  4. 4
    Peel back vapor barrier
    Carefully peel back the plastic vapor barrier around the speaker location only. Do not fully remove the barrier. Use caution to avoid tearing the plastic as it needs to reseal properly. The speaker will be visible mounted to the inner door structure.
  5. 5
    Disconnect speaker harness
    Locate the speaker electrical connector and press the locking tab to disconnect it from the speaker terminals. Note the connector orientation for reinstallation.
  6. 6
    Remove speaker mounting bolts
    Using a 10mm socket, remove the three mounting bolts securing the speaker to the door frame. Support the speaker as you remove the final bolt to prevent it from falling into the door cavity. Remove the speaker from the door.
  7. 7
    Install new speaker
    Position the new speaker in the door mounting location, ensuring the mounting holes align with the door frame. Thread all three mounting bolts by hand first to ensure proper alignment. Tighten the mounting bolts in a star pattern to 8.0 Nm (6 lb-ft) if using module mounting spec, or snug by hand plus 1/4 turn if torque wrench is unavailable.
  8. 8
    Connect speaker harness
    Reconnect the electrical connector to the new speaker, ensuring it clicks into place fully. Verify the connection is secure by gently tugging on the connector.
  9. 9
    Reseal vapor barrier
    Press the vapor barrier back into place firmly around the edges to ensure a proper seal. This prevents moisture from entering the door panel area and affecting the new speaker.
  10. 10
    Reinstall door panel
    Reconnect all electrical connectors through the door panel openings before positioning the panel. Lift the panel and hook the top edge over the window sill, then press firmly around all edges to engage the retaining clips. Reinstall all screws and any trim pieces removed earlier. Reconnect the battery negative terminal.

Reassembly

  1. Ensure all door panel clips are fully seated by pressing firmly around the entire perimeter
  2. Verify all screws are reinstalled in their original locations
  3. Check that the door handle and window switches operate freely without binding

Verification

  • Reconnect battery and start the vehicle
  • Test the new speaker by adjusting the audio system balance/fader to that specific speaker
  • Verify clear audio output without distortion, rattling, or buzzing
  • Test all door functions including window operation, lock switches, and mirror controls
  • Inspect door panel fit and ensure no gaps or loose areas remain
